When and where was Speedling founded?
Speedling was founded in 1968 in Sun City, Florida, with the invention of Speedling Planter Flats. The planter flats used inverted pyramid technology that produced “speedy seedlings” – and with that Speedling was born.

What is a plant plug?
A plant plug is a young plant grown specifically to be transplanted and grown to full size. Speedling produces vegetable transplants primarily sold to commercial farmers and ornamental transplants sold to ornamental retailers and retail suppliers.

Do you hot water treat your seed?
We hot water treat most of the Brassica family seed. This includes but is not limited to cabbage, broccoli, collards, cauliflower, mustard and turnips.

What is EPS?
EPS stands for expanded polystyrene which are the small white beads we expand and form into trays and fish boxes. It is also the name of our manufacturing division that produces these trays and boxes.
